Explain the uses of arithmetic processor
A processor has arithmetic processor (as a sub part of it) which executes arithmetic operations. The data type, assumed to reside in the processor, registers during execution of an arithmetic instruction. Negative numbers can be in a signed magnitude or signed complement representation. There are three ways of demonstrating negative fixed point these are- binary numbers signed magnitude, signed 1's complement or signed 2's complement. Most computers use signed magnitude representation for mantissa.
